Haredi Jews Dress Children as Holocaust Camp Inmates in Jerusalem Protest

Sunday, January 1st, 2012
haredi children in holocaust camp inmate uniforms

Haredi children in Holocaust camp inmate uniforms (Olivier Pitoussi)

Now I know the Israel’s Haredi community has truly lost its mind.  In Beit Shemesh, they began by spitting on an Orthodox 8-year-old Israeli-American girl making her way to school, because she was dressed “immodestly.”  When the rest of Israel rose in arms at the outrage of this act, the Haredim responded by protesting, trashing parts of the town and lighting fires.  Their idea is that it’s no one else’s friggin’ business what they do in their communities, so butt out bud.

Tonight, they protested in Jerusalem and as part of the festivities they dressed their children in stripped, Holocaust camp inmate uniforms replete with Jewish stars.  The point being…what…what point can there be in this?  That the rest of Israel is murdering them simply because they’re Jews?

The cheap blackmail of this trickery is astonishing.  And despite what anyone may tell you in Israel, it works.  No one crosses these people.  They own the place.  The authorities and politicians cater to their every whim.  In the Territories, the Haredi settlements and yeshivot produce some of the most virulent, violent perpetrators of murder and violence.  These people generally don’t even recognize the secular state as their own.  They vastly prefer the creation of a “Torah-true” theocratic state.  And they’re not above violent rebellion against the authority of the current state.  That’s what price tag violence is all about.

If I’m not mistaken, the Taliban Jews in Israel, who force their women to dress in head to toe chador-like clothing are Haredi.  These are sects which like women only as baby-producing machines.  If you’re not one of their women, you might as well be dirt under their feet.  It’s the Haredi who insist that their public transportation be gender segregated.  They’ll spit on you or scream at you when you dare not to move to the back of the bus.

The next time you hear an Islamophobe or hasbarist railing about the oppression of women in Islamist societies, remind them that Israel has its own Taliban.  And don’t be fooled by anyone who says they are an extreme minority.  This community is by far the fastest growing in all Israel.  Birth-rates are through the roof.  It’s also by far the poorest, least well-educated, and most isolated from the outside world.  This, I’m sorry to say, stands to be the future of Israel if things don’t change in the coming years.
